In Petty, Texas, a small unincorporated community in Lamar County, residents can benefit greatly from Virtual Intensive Outpatient Programs (IOP). This flexible treatment option is designed to address mental health and substance use disorders, providing vital support to individuals who may find it challenging to attend in-person sessions due to work or family obligations. Given Petty's close-knit nature, having localized online therapy can foster a sense of community while tackling these serious issues.
For the approximately 4,270 residents of Petty, Virtual IOP offers a range of advantages. The ability to engage in structured therapy from the comfort of home eliminates commuting time, allowing individuals to maintain their work, school, and family commitments while receiving essential care. With access to licensed therapists and various evidence-based treatments—including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T)—participants can effectively address challenges related to depression, anxiety, PTSD, and more.
Starting with a Virtual IOP is straightforward. Interested individuals can explore local programs that accept their insurance and cater to their specific needs. Typically requiring 9-20 hours of therapy per week, sessions are available 3-5 days a week, providing both individual and group therapy options. By utilizing HIPAA-compliant video platforms, Petty residents can begin their journey to recovery today without the barriers of traditional therapy settings.
